Cinnamon-headed Green-Pigeon Treron fulvicollis

Generally uncommon forest pigeon. Male’s pinkish-orange head is unique. Female is less distinctive; note red-and-white bill, dark eyes, and extensively pale-fringed wing feathers. Inhabits coastal forests; found in mangroves, swampy forest, and adjacent scrub. Gives a series of high whistling coos, often rising and falling in pitch and duration.
